Why Choose a Career in Phlebotomy in Houston?
Houston offers a robust and diverse healthcare scene, with employment opportunities in hospitals, clinics, laboratories, and specialized medical centers. The demand for trained phlebotomists is expected to grow by approximately 10% over the next decade, driven by an aging population and advanced diagnostic testing.
Some key reasons to consider phlebotomy as your career include:
- High Job Demand: The need for blood collection professionals exceeds supply.
- Competitive Salaries: Entry-level positions start around $30,000 annually, with experienced phlebotomists earning over $45,000.
- Flexible Work Settings: Opportunities across hospitals, private laboratories, outpatient clinics, and mobile blood donation drives.
- Career advancement: Pathways to become lead phlebotomist, supervisor, or move into related healthcare roles.
Top Phlebotomy Jobs in Houston
Below are the most sought-after phlebotomy roles in Houston, highlighting what makes each position desirable for aspiring professionals.
| Job Title | Key Responsibilities | Average Salary Range | Work Settings | Certification Required |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Hospitals phlebotomist | Blood collection in inpatient and outpatient settings, patient planning | $30,000 – $45,000 | Major hospitals & medical centers | Certified Phlebotomy Technician (CPT) |
| Lab Technician | Sample collection, data entry, specimen processing | $32,000 – $47,000 | Medical laboratories | Certified or Registered Phlebotomist |
| Mobile Blood Collection Specialist | Conducting blood drives at various locations, donor management | $28,000 – $40,000 | Mobile units, community centers | Certification preferred |
| Private Clinic Phlebotomist | Blood draws for outpatient services, routine testing | $30,000 – $42,000 | Private practices and outpatient clinics | CPR Certification + Phlebotomy Certification |
| Travel Phlebotomist | Providing temporary coverage at various healthcare facilities | $35,000 – $50,000 | Multiple locations within texas | Certification required |

Practical Tips for Landing the Best Phlebotomy Jobs in Houston
- Get Certified: Enroll in accredited phlebotomy training programs recognized by the National Healthcareer Association (NHA) or American Society for Clinical Pathology (ASCP).
- Build Experience: Consider volunteering or completing internships at local hospitals or clinics to gain practical skills.
- Perfect Your Resume: Highlight certifications, relevant experience, and soft skills like communication and patient care.
- Network: Join local healthcare job fairs, associations, and online platforms like Indeed or LinkedIn.
- Stay Informed: Keep up with the latest healthcare trends and certifications to remain competitive.
